Sand tiger sharks hover in the water as they patiently wait for fish to swim by. To hover, they gulp air at the waters surface and hold it in their bellies! Through engaging photos and text, this leveled title introduces readers to the sand tiger sharks fascinating hunting behaviors, body functions, and environment. Added features further highlight the sharks size, diet, range, and more!

"The Greatest Game Ever Played" was in 1958 between the Indianapolis Colts and the New York Giants. This match is said to have popularized professional football! With Hall of Famers Johnny Unitas, Jim Parker, Raymond Berry, and Lenny Moore, the Colts beat the Giants 23-17. Today, the Colts play at Lucas Oil Stadium, a state-of-the-art facility with a retractable roof. Readers can learn more fun facts about the Colts' history in this title packed with...
